Erythrophagocytic tumour cells in melanoma and squamous cell carcinoma of the skin

1997

Aims: Erythrophagocytosis is a characteristic feature of tumour cells in malignant histiocytosis, some leukaemias, lymphomas, and also reactive histiocytes in the haemophagocytic syndrome associated with a variety of infections and neoplasms. It has also been found exceptionally in metastatic malignant epithelial cells in bone marrow and lymph nodes. We present two cases, a cutaneous malignant melanoma and an acantholytic squamous cell carcinoma, in which erythrophagocytosis by tumour cells was demonstrable by both light and electron microscopy. Diagnostic value of CD34 immunostaining in desmoplastic trichilemmoma.

1998

Desmoplastic trichilemmoma (DT) is a variant of trichilemmoma, characterized by a central prominent desmoplastic component which may simulate invasive carcinoma. We have studied the morphologic and immunohistochemical features of seven cases of DT. Immunohistochemistry was performed on paraffin sections using monoclonal antibodies to CD34 (QBEND/10), vimentin and GCDFP-15. CD34 was also tested in seven cases of basal cell carcinoma (BCC), three with outer root sheath differentiation and four with morphea-form features, and five squamous cell carcinomas. Prognosis in lower lip squamous cell carcinoma: assessment of tumor factors.

1998

We studied a consecutive series of 54 cases of lower lip squamous cell carcinoma (LLSCC) in order to identify any variables which might predict the development of lymph node metastases. The cases were divided into 38 tumors without metastases (group I) and 16 tumors with lymph node metastases (group II). The following factors were investigated: tumor size, histologic grading maximal thickness, perineural invasion, DNA ploidy and PCNA expression. In conclusion, we found that LLSCC greater than 2 cm in diameter, with histological grading G3-G4, thickness of more than 6 mm, DNA aneuploidy and high PCNA expression (PCNA LI > 0.48), were at high risk for the development of lymph node metastases.
